Parashat Noah: In This Week's Parashah

In This Week’s Parashah: מָה בַּפָּרָשָׁה​​​​​​​

Full Parashah Reading: Bereishit 6:9-11:32
  • The world becomes wicked, so God decides to destroy the world, and God commands Noah to build a תֵּיבָה (teivah, ark).
  • Noah is told to get himself and his family, two of every non-kosher animal, and fourteen of every kosher animal on the teivah.
  • It rains for 40 days and nights, creating a flood that destroys everything.
  • The flood lasts for 150 days.
  • Noah sends out a raven, then a dove to see if the water has gone away. The dove returns with an olive branch in its mouth.
  • God tells Noah to leave the teivah and repopulate the earth.
  • God promises never to destroy the world through a flood again, and makes a rainbow the sign of that promise.
  • The people of the world all speak the same language, and begin to build a מִגְדָל (migdal, tower).
  • God confuses the people with different languages, so the place is called בָּבֶל (bavel, confusion), and God scatters them over the earth.
